New Student Inauguration Concludes the PPMB 2026 at the FMIPA UNEJ

Prof. Drs. Dafik, M.Sc., Ph.D., Dean of FMIPA UNEJ, officially concluded the 2026 Faculty-level Pembinaan dan Pengembangan Mahasiswa Baru (PPMB) program on September 13. The event culminated in an inauguration night featuring an arts performance by the new students. The 2026 PPMB program covered topics such as PKM, ONMIPA, PPK ORMAWA, PKM mentoring, and a UKM expo. “With the material provided, students are expected to keep learning without giving up in order to achieve success,” the Dean stated. In the current era, students must become autonomous learners taking initiative and responsibility for their studies rather than relying solely on instructors or lecturers.

The Dean of the FMIPA UNEJ stated that new students are expected to learn not only about their specific scientific disciplines but also about a wide range of subjects, aiming to become multitalented individuals. “To truly shine, you must master various areas; that radiance will emanate from the knowledge you possess within yourself,” he remarked. Prof. Dafik also highlighted “ARUNIKA” signifying the first rays of light after sunrise as well as the 2026 PPMB theme: Melangkah Bersama, Menembus Cakrawala. “With the spirit of ARUNIKA, new students must put these values ​​into practice and pursue their studies at FMIPA with enthusiasm, so that they may attain a future filled with the light of new hope,” he concluded.

Following the conclusion of PPMB 2026, a ribbon-cutting ceremony marked the start of the FMIPA PPMB 2026 inauguration event. Each class presented a theatrical drama performance. Joy seemed to overshadow any fatigue, while the camaraderie and unity displayed by each class won the admiration of both the new students and the PPMB 2026 organizing committee. “We tried something different this year; the inauguration was held in the evening and featured various vendor stalls. The new students’ class performances were also judged to determine the best act with attractive prizes up for grabs, of course,” said Nadia, Chairperson of the FMIPA PPMB 2026 Organizing Committee. The festivities were lively and spirited, all while maintaining order and ensuring the well-being of the new students, who had classes to attend the following day.

During the second week, new students were introduced to the UKM within the FMIPA. These student organizations, along with BEM and the BPM, presented their work programs, activities, and achievements. “Each student organization and UKM at FMIPA was given the opportunity to attract new members by introducing their committee members, flagship programs, and past achievements,” stated Arya Maulana, President of BEMF MIPA. Highlights included PALAPA organizing a mini-camp and a flying fox activity, IONS introducing archery, and UKMS TITIK staging a mini-performance at the FMIPA student organization building. Finally, representatives from BEMF MIPA and BPM visited classrooms to share details about their work programs and achievements, as well as the initiatives planned for the upcoming year.
